- The Brihadisvara temple located in Gangaikonda Cholapuram, Tamilnadu is one of the oldest structure built by Rajendra Chola-I in 11th Century AD. This is the Hindu temple built in Dravidian architecture style. The temple is entirely built with granite stones and the temple contains many monolithic sculptures in it. Also tamil words are inscribed in the wall of the temple. This temple is dedicated to Lord shiva and it is a UNESCO world heritage site.
